Opening in the red hot Ardmore restaurant scene, Lola's will showcase the culinary skills of acclaimed former Russet Chef Andrew Wood. The seasonal menus will showcase uniquely paired, honest, local ingredients together with small bites, salads, sandwiches, entrees, and desserts that showcase his culinary skills and artistry with a focus on not more than a handful of ingredients on the plate.
At the bar, look for a celebration of all things Pennsylvania with 15 all local and state beers on tap, and an entire wine program with taps and bottles showcasing the state's best selections. The cocktail program will feature more than a dozen draft and hand-crafted cocktails - including new cocktail flights.
For vibes, Lola's Garden is unlike any restaurant that currently exists in the area with a stunning beer and wine garden patio with a giant four-season 2,500 square foot outdoor trellis - and an additional outdoor bar with seating. The eclectic garden setting that will feature lush greenery and flowers, complemented by repurposed and recycled natural materials and found objects, with comfortable and community living room style seating and stylings. Even the inside dining spaces will have the look and feel as if you are in the great outdoors. Hornik, who has become locally famous for his lavish use of natural, vibrant elements in decorating his venues, led the interior design team personally. Like Harper's Garden, look for green-house stylings and all-weather seating with heat and covering during the fall and into the winter.
Lola's Garden was designed with safety and the focus around outdoor dining in mind - with 240+ seats with 140 seats located outdoors on the sidewalk cafe and in the trellis.
